The heart of the role
As our Quality Education Manager, you will lead the home in relation to quality care and services, ensuring quality governance, compliance and the competency of team members is delivered to achieve the requirements of the Aged Care Quality Standards. You will assist in identifying improvement opportunities as well as hands on support in remediating gaps, and coaching Care Home leadership team for sustainability.
In this role, you will
•Provide quality focused leadership and coaching.
•Provide guidance in relation to documentation/recording to ensure care and services provided meets expected outcomes.
•Develop team members knowledge and understanding of expectations of practice within the framework of the Aged Care Quality Standards and their own scope of practice.
•Identify areas of employee's skills/knowledge that require further learning/competency development and create a plan to achieve this
•Ensure care home and team members are prepared through preparedness activities and maintains currency of the Commission Entry Questions.
•Maintain the Care Home's Plan for Continuous Improvement (PCI) in collaboration with leadership team Meet monthly or more frequently with the GM and CCM's to review and track progress of PCI items.
•Complete month end Quality Indicator Report, including analysing data, discussing, and articulating insights with CCMs and GMs, and ensuring improvements are transferred to the PCI and implemented.
•Responsible for ensuring Government NQIP (National Quality Indicator) program data is submitted in line with Bupa timeframes, and analysed, with any improvements documented and actioned.
•Coordinates the completion of all monthly Care Home Audits within the Operations Essential audit program.
•Management and delivery of the highest quality clinical care of Residents person centred care for residents, including assessment, planning, implementation, and evaluation.
•Maintain accurate records and documentation consistent with policy, legislation, and privacy requirements.

What will you bring?
•Bachelor of Nursing with current APHRA is essential.
•Postgraduate qualification in Aged Care and Cert IV in Training and Assessment (TAE40116) is desirable.
•Proven track record in delivering quality clinical care, coaching, delivering training.
•Ability to foster a team environment and build collaborative relationships.
•Highly effective communication, leadership, and relationship management skills
•An understanding of Resident Rights, Aged Care Accreditation Standards and Outcomes
